The ABI expressed support for the government's renewed commitment to investment in flood defences and management.

ABI acting head of general insurance Jane Milne said: “The government's renewed commitment to an investment of at least £564m in flood management over the next three years is very welcome.”

She added: “This announcement marks an important step towards a robust and integrated approach to flood management. This is essential if the government's plans for growth in new homes like Thames Gateway are adequately protected from flooding.

“Insurers are playing a full part in improving flood management through the successful implementation of our Statement of Principles, which ensures that the vast majority of homeowners can get insurance against flooding, while setting targets for the government to improve protection against flooding.”

Milne made the comments as Environment Minister Elliott Morley launched a consultation on flooding and coastal erosion management.

The ABI said it welcomed the government's commitment to review its planning policy on flooding.
